November 2023 by Elizabeth Flores
I highly support and recommend TCAP. Very affordable rates and despite being overwhelmed, they manage to get people and animals out quickly. Review their website to know what to expect. I often get there at least 30 mins before they open to be one of the first in line. You will be waiting outside or in your car and pets must be on a leash for their and others' safety. The wait can be long at times, but that's why it pays to be there early. Sometimes it takes me an hour and a half, most recently only a half hour. Be prepared to wait and dress weather appropriate.
